    Stopped by last night for Happy Hour and had a great time! I walked into a crowded bar and it was only 1700! Found the only open seat and made myself at home. I had been here once before and was salivating for their Jamaican Jerk Chicken. Ordered that and Macaroni and Cheese with a Delirium Tremen on tap. Simply marvelous!
    Sat next to a bunch of regulars who bragged about just about everything on the menu. Next up was a Speakeasy Big Daddy IPA on tap. They have about 20 draft beers and 50 bottles/cans. Their  food menu features lots of appetizers (which are half price during HH), wings, salads, burgers and entrees. I spyed some really great looking dishes go by and really wanted to take a bite of the roast beef with cheese sandwich which my neighbor was plowing through but thought that my new friends may not quite like that. But I am coming back for more. That's for sure!

    I thought the beer list was more than formidable.  They represent various Long Island brewers very well, with a mix of others, too.

    I don't know how often they change the taps though; I've only been there once.

    There's a different price for each beer which I thought was weird; one was $6.50 and another $8.00; according to the bill.  They advertised a $5.00 special on Long Ireland draft like it was a good deal.  

    The menu is typical bar far, with many different types of chicken wings.  The jerk rub was good, but the wings lacked the indefinable characteristic that has you running back.  Honestly, the whole menu seemed uninspired.  

    I was very surprised however to find 20 or so people inside (all guys) on a Sunday at noon.  Must have a good following.

    So, Ive been to Cory's Ale house before but this past weekend was the first time that I have been there to try their food.

    First off, the place is sooo welcoming and tastefully decorated a far cry from the Wantagh Inn and Mulchaey's that are very near by.  I think this area needed a place like this where you can come chill have some good
    beers and  hang out with friends

    The food was delicious and a great value for the money.  The Buffalo wings were not terribly spicy but the sauce was good none the less.  The fish and chips were very nice.  A fluffy batter with flakey fish.  The portions are just right not huge, but also not skimpy.  Friends burger was nice an pink on the inside, and what I observed other people eating also looked very good as well

    The waiter we had was great knew his beer list very well was able to talk about what they had on tap and a warm person all around.  The manager or owner not sure what she was walked around and made sure everyone was happy and satisfied.

    If you are looking for good beer, and great value for good food then I highly suggest you check this place out on your next venture
